Robert is an ambitious attorney who is on top of the world. He is the star at his office, on the fast track and engaged to his soul mate, the captivating Christian. Life could not be better, until a larger firm abruptly acquires Robert’s company. What follows is a web of lies, greed and betrayal that threatens to destroy Robert's professional life and the world around him. He must grapple with his inner conscience and the invisible forces of corruption surrounding him while dealing with the equally challenging and deceptive forces taking hold in his sordid love life.
Sarbane's Oxley begs the question: What happens when you mix a little corporate misconduct with a lot of misconduct of your own? Loosely titled after the law implemented to prevent the hidden corruption that destroyed corporations like Enron in recent years, Sarbane's Oxley examines the issue of accountability in both professional and personal settings.
